| Virtualization Engine on Linux for zSeries
|
|
| This presentation will give you an Overview of the Virtualization Engine
(VE) for zSeries. VE is a collection of products that can be used to manage your
enterprise from health monitoring, system cloning, workload management and more.
This presentation will give you a high level technical overview of products that
make up Virtualization Engine which are Enterprise Workload Manager (EWLM),
IBM Director, and Resource Dependency Services (RDS). We will discuss capabilities
of the products and how they can help you to manage your enterprise. We will also
discuss the VE Console which can be the main entry point into the VE management
collection.

| System z9 Technology Announcements
|
|
| IBM is extending the System z9 to work for businesses large and small,
delivering more choice and greater flexibility with the new IBM System z9
Business Class (z9 BC) and the improved IBM System z9 Enterprise Class (z9 EC).
System z9 BC is IBM's latest offering. Designed for smaller enterprises,
it delivers key mainframe strengths such as availability, scalability and
security in a customized package. And on the System z9 EC, IBM has improved
granularity, so you now have the ability to select the configuration
that's right for you. Come and hear the latest news on the System z9
Technology Announcements.

| Secure Socket Layer on z/VM
|
|
| In October of 2000, IBM announced an SSL server for VM. This implementation
was done using LINUX on VM. I will discuss:
- What is SSL?
- How is the VM SSL Server set up?
- Steps to make it work.
This will give you a better understanding of SSL and SSL on VM.
